Technology and Concept Overview of Business Jets
Business jets are a category of aircraft designed specifically for private, corporate, or group travel. Unlike commercial airliners, these jets prioritize speed, comfort, and direct routes over passenger volume. They range from small light jets like the Cessna Citation Mustang to ultra-long-range aircraft such as the Gulfstream G700.
Key technologies embedded in business jets include advanced avionics systems, fly-by-wire controls, efficient turbofan engines, and luxurious cabin amenities designed for productivity and comfort. Recent innovations focus heavily on fuel efficiency and lower emissions, aligning with industry-wide sustainability goals.
These jets operate from smaller airports, offering access to locations closer to final destinations and bypassing congested hubs. This flexibility is central to their appeal, enabling faster boarding and disembarking processes.
Industry Applications & Real-World Use Cases
Business jets serve a broad spectrum of industries, including finance, technology, healthcare, and entertainment. For instance, technology executives often use business jets to rapidly shuttle between innovation hubs like Silicon Valley and international clients, drastically reducing travel downtime.
One notable case study is the use of business jets by pharmaceutical companies during the COVID-19 pandemic. These jets facilitated swift transport of executives and critical personnel to manage supply chains and regulatory meetings worldwide, proving essential in crisis management.
Moreover, sports teams and entertainment celebrities frequently charter business jets to accommodate tight schedules and privacy needs, emphasizing the jets' role beyond traditional corporate use.
Market Trends & Growth Drivers
The global business jet market continues to expand robustly, with a forecasted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of approximately 5.7% between 2023 and 2030, according to industry reports. This growth is fueled by increasing corporate globalization and the rising demand for efficient, secure travel.
Emerging trends include the adoption of digital booking platforms that simplify chartering procedures and fractional ownership models that make business jets more accessible to mid-sized companies. Additionally, the push toward sustainable aviation has spurred development in hybrid-electric propulsion and sustainable aviation fuels (SAFs).
Regions like North America and the Middle East dominate the business jet market, with Asia Pacific emerging as a high-potential area due to economic growth and expanding corporate sectors.

Benefits & Advantages of Business Jets
One of the most compelling advantages of business jets is the significant reduction in travel time. By flying direct routes and avoiding commercial airport delays, executives can reclaim valuable hours otherwise lost in transit.
- Privacy and security: Business jets provide a secure environment for confidential discussions, which is vital for sensitive business negotiations.
- Flexibility: Flights can be scheduled on-demand, adapting quickly to changing business needs without being bound by commercial airline timetables.
- Enhanced productivity: The quiet, well-equipped cabins enable executives to work, hold meetings, or rest during flights.
- Access to remote locations: Business jets can land on shorter runways, granting access to airports not serviced by commercial flights.
From an investment perspective, companies that utilize business jets often see a positive ROI by accelerating deal-making processes and improving operational efficiency.
Challenges & Future Outlook
Despite their advantages, business jets face several challenges. High acquisition and operational costs remain significant barriers, particularly for smaller businesses. Additionally, environmental concerns over carbon emissions are increasing regulatory and social pressure on private aviation.
To address these issues, manufacturers and operators are investing in greener technologies, including electric propulsion and sustainable fuel alternatives. Digital innovations like AI-driven flight optimization and enhanced maintenance analytics promise to improve efficiency and reduce costs.
Looking ahead, the business jet sector is poised for transformative growth, particularly as hybrid models and autonomous flight technology mature. The integration of smart cabin systems will further enhance passenger experience, making business jets even more indispensable for corporate travel.
